I recently used up my supply of SK Standard Plus and started using some SK Pistol Match that I have. This morning when it was pretty much wind still I wanted to shoot a 10 shot group at 100 yards. It’s better than I ever did with Standard Plus but I don’t know if I could do it again. But I’ll take it!

Specs:
2” target
100 YDS
10 shots
Group size .82

Agreed. I bought a 457 VPC on sale a few years back. I wanted the 24" but all that was left was the 16" version. The price was too good to pass up so I ordered the 16" VPC. I also ordered a 20" MTR barrel with the intent of swapping it in as soon as the rifle arrived. Long story short, a quick test on the 16" barrel showed it routinely shot one hole groups at 50 yds! I ended up leaving that barrel on there for many months until a Lilja eventually replaced it. That 16" barrel now lives on my 457 THB (Thumbhole) and is never going anywhere!

The easy part is making a barrel that is capable of sub-moa. The hard part is acquiring ammo that can realize this potential. I could shoot a dozen groups at 100 yards with my DJ custom 455 and maybe only get a handful in the 0.900’s or a little better. If only the ammo companies would be so kind as to offer at least one bench rest grade of ammo, results like that could be more common.
